Mastercam X72022 Virtual Usb Bus Link -
Mastercam X7 2022 Virtual USB Bus Link Guide
Introduction
Mastercam X7 2022 is a powerful CAD/CAM software used for CNC machining. The Virtual USB Bus Link is a feature that allows you to license and activate Mastercam using a virtual USB device. This guide will walk you through the process of setting up and using the Virtual USB Bus Link.
System Requirements
- Mastercam X7 2022 installed on your computer
- A valid Mastercam license
- A computer with a working internet connection
Step 1: Install the Virtual USB Bus Link
- Download the Virtual USB Bus Link installer from the Mastercam website.
- Run the installer and follow the prompts to install the software.
- Once installed, restart your computer.
Step 2: Configure the Virtual USB Bus Link
- Open the Mastercam X7 2022 software.
- Click on Help > Licensing > Virtual USB Bus Link.
- In the Virtual USB Bus Link dialog box, click on Configure.
- Select the Virtual USB Device option and click Next.
- Choose a port number (e.g., 5000) and click Next.
- Click Finish to complete the configuration.
Step 3: Activate the Virtual USB Bus Link
- Go to the Mastercam website and log in to your account.
- Click on Licenses > Activate License.
- Select the Virtual USB Bus Link option and enter the port number you chose in Step 2.
- Click Activate to activate the license.
Step 4: Verify the Virtual USB Bus Link
- Open the Mastercam X7 2022 software.
- Click on Help > Licensing > Virtual USB Bus Link.
- Verify that the Virtual USB Bus Link is listed as Connected.
Troubleshooting
- If you encounter issues with the Virtual USB Bus Link, ensure that the software is installed and configured correctly.
- Check that the port number is correct and that the license is activated.
- If you are still experiencing issues, contact Mastercam support for assistance.
Best Practices
- Ensure that the Virtual USB Bus Link is configured and activated correctly to avoid licensing issues.
- Regularly check for updates to the Virtual USB Bus Link software.
- Use a reliable internet connection to activate and verify the license.
By following these steps and best practices, you should be able to successfully set up and use the Virtual USB Bus Link with Mastercam X7 2022. If you encounter any issues, refer to the troubleshooting section or contact Mastercam support.
Mastercam Virtual USB Bus Link (often associated with ) is a software emulator used to bypass the physical hardware lock (dongle) required to run Mastercam. While it allows the software to function without a physical USB key, it is primarily a tool found in "cracked" or unauthorized versions of the software. 🛠️ How it Works Mastercam typically uses a
security key. The virtual bus link tricks Windows into thinking a physical security dongle is plugged into a USB port.
Acts as a "bridge" between the software and the Windows registry. Appears in Device Manager under System Devices as "Virtual USB Bus Enumerator" or "Virtual USB MultiKey". Registry Dumps: Requires specific
files that contain the encrypted "license" data the software looks for. ⚠️ Common Errors & Fixes
Using virtual drivers often leads to system instability or "No License Found" errors, especially after Windows updates. Error Code 39 (Signature Issues) Windows often blocks these drivers because they lack a digital signature You must enable Disable Driver Signature Enforcement
in Windows Startup settings to allow the unsigned driver to load. Error Code -3 or 7
These usually indicate a conflict with existing HASP drivers or an incomplete installation. (Standard system devices) Mastercam X7-2022 Virtual Usb Bus
Mastercam X7 2022 Overview
Mastercam X7 2022 is a computer-aided manufacturing (CAM) software designed for CNC machining. It's a powerful tool used for milling, drilling, and turning operations. The software provides a comprehensive set of tools for designing, simulating, and producing CNC programs.
Virtual USB Bus Link
The virtual USB bus link is a feature in Mastercam X7 2022 that allows for a secure and reliable connection between the software and the CNC machine. This link enables the transfer of data between the software and the machine, ensuring that the CNC program is executed accurately.
Useful Review
Here's a review of Mastercam X7 2022 with its virtual USB bus link:
Pros:
- Improved accuracy: The virtual USB bus link ensures a stable and accurate connection between the software and the CNC machine, reducing errors and increasing productivity.
- Streamlined workflow: The software's intuitive interface and comprehensive toolset enable users to design, simulate, and produce CNC programs efficiently.
- Enhanced security: The virtual USB bus link provides an additional layer of security, protecting against unauthorized access and data corruption.
Cons:
- Steep learning curve: Mastercam X7 2022 requires a significant investment of time and effort to master, especially for users new to CAM software.
- System requirements: The software demands a robust computer system, which can be a challenge for users with lower-end hardware.
Key Features
Some notable features of Mastercam X7 2022 include:
- Mill, Lathe, and Router support: The software supports a wide range of CNC machines, including mills, lathes, and routers.
- Advanced simulation: The software offers advanced simulation capabilities, allowing users to test and validate their CNC programs before execution.
- Post-processing: Mastercam X7 2022 includes a range of post-processing options, enabling users to customize their CNC programs for specific machines.
Conclusion
Mastercam X7 2022 with its virtual USB bus link is a powerful CAM software solution for CNC machining. While it may have a steep learning curve, the software offers a comprehensive set of tools and features that can improve productivity, accuracy, and security. If you're in the market for a reliable CAM software, Mastercam X7 2022 is definitely worth considering.
Rating: 4.5/5
Mastercam X7 2022 Virtual USB Bus Link " typically refers to the driver environment used for software licensing (HASP/MultiKey) , you can leverage the Virtual Toolbars feature in Mastercam 2022
to create a custom "Smart Dashboard" that speeds up your programming by up to 2x Google Groups Feature Idea: The "Dynamic CAM Control Hub"
Instead of digging through standard menus, you can build a customized virtual interface that bridges your most-used X7-style legacy workflows with 2022's advanced automation. Adaptive Toolpath Icons
: Mastercam 2022 introduced updated icons for the Toolpath Manager and Solids tab. You can pin these to a Virtual Toolbar
that only appears when specific geometry is selected, reducing screen clutter. Auto-Regenerate Toggle : Add a dedicated button to your virtual bar for the Automatic Regeneration
feature. This allows you to see toolpath changes in real-time without manual clicks, which is a major efficiency jump from the X7 era. Simplified Interface Switch
: If you are training others or moving between complex and simple parts, use the Interface Selector
in the top corner to toggle between "Standard" and "Simplified" views. Live Engraving Notes : Use the 2022 Dynamic Notes
feature to create an "on-tool" dashboard. Unlike X7's fixed geometry text, these notes update automatically when edited, allowing you to track job details directly on the 3D model. Troubleshooting the "Virtual USB Bus"
If you are seeing "Error 39" or "HASP not found" related to the Virtual USB Bus link: Driver Conflict
: This is often caused by 3D Connexion mouse drivers or specialized USB peripherals interfering with the licensing emulator. Corrupt Profile
: A common fix for persistent USB HASP issues in Mastercam is deleting and recreating the Windows User Profile , as multiple crashes can corrupt the registry links. System Inspector Mastercam System Inspector Utility
to generate a diagnostic report if the virtual link fails to initialize. Google Groups for your most frequent 2022 operations? Mastercam X7-2022 Virtual Usb Bus Error 39 - Google Groups
Mastercam X7-2022: Navigating the Virtual USB Bus Link A common hurdle for users of legacy Mastercam versions (like X7) and modern releases (up to 2022) is managing the Virtual USB Bus Enumerator. This software component acts as a bridge, allowing the operating system to recognize virtual security dongles or "keys" required to run the software without a physical hardware plug. What is the Virtual USB Bus Link?
Mastercam historically used physical USB Hasselp/Aladdin dongles for license verification. To streamline workflows or support network-based licensing, a Virtual USB Bus Link is often used. It mimics a physical USB port at the driver level, tricking the software into seeing a valid license key even if no physical device is attached. Key Drivers and Components
To ensure a stable connection between Mastercam and your license, several components must work in harmony:
Sentinel HASP/LDK Drivers: The foundation for most Mastercam licensing. You can download the latest GUI Run-time installers directly from the Thales (formerly Gemalto) support portal.
Virtual USB Bus Enumerator: Usually found in the System Devices section of your Windows Device Manager. If this has a yellow exclamation mark, your virtual link is broken.
CodeMeter Runtime: Used in more recent versions (2020–2022) alongside or instead of HASP for improved security and cloud licensing. Troubleshooting Common Connection Issues
If Mastercam fails to launch or reports "No SIM found," follow these steps to reset the virtual link:
Check Device Manager: Right-click 'Start' > 'Device Manager'. Look under 'Universal Serial Bus controllers' or 'System devices' for any "Virtual USB" entries.
Update the Driver: Often, Windows Updates can break custom virtual bus links. Right-click the device and select "Update driver," or reinstall the Mastercam-specific driver package provided in your installation folder (usually under C:\Program Files\mcam[version]\common). mastercam x72022 virtual usb bus link
Disable Driver Signature Enforcement: Some older virtual bus links are "unsigned." Modern Windows 10/11 requires signed drivers. You may need to boot into Advanced Startup and select "Disable Driver Signature Enforcement" to get the link to initialize.
Check the "MultiKey" or "USB Emulator" Service: Ensure that the background service managing the virtual link is set to "Running" in services.msc. Transitioning to Modern Licensing
If you are moving from X7 to 2022, Mastercam has largely shifted toward Software-Based Licensing (Hasp HL or Software SIM). This removes the need for complex virtual USB bus links by tying the license directly to your computer's "fingerprint" or a cloud account via the Mastercam License Manager. If you'd like, let me know: The exact error message you are seeing Your Windows version (10 or 11)
If you are using a physical dongle or a software-only license I can give you a step-by-step fix for your specific setup.
Understanding the Mastercam Virtual USB Bus Link: A Technical Guide
For many CAD/CAM professionals, the transition between different versions of Mastercam—specifically when moving from legacy systems like Mastercam X7 toward modern releases like Mastercam 2022—often presents a unique challenge: hardware lock management.
At the heart of this challenge is the Virtual USB Bus Link, a software layer designed to bridge the gap between physical security dongles (HASP/NetHASP) and the Windows operating environment. What is the Virtual USB Bus Link?
The Virtual USB Bus Link is an emulator driver. In the world of high-end CNC programming software, "dongles" are used to prevent unauthorized copying. However, physical dongles can fail, get lost, or create compatibility issues with modern 64-bit operating systems or virtual machines.
A virtual bus link "tricks" the software into believing a physical USB security key is plugged into the motherboard, even if the license is being managed digitally or via an older emulator protocol. The Evolution: Mastercam X7 to 2022
The technological leap between Mastercam X7 (released circa 2013) and Mastercam 2022 is massive.
Mastercam X7: One of the last versions to heavily rely on older driver signatures and the Hasp HL architecture.
Mastercam 2022: Fully optimized for Windows 10 and 11, requiring strict driver signature enforcement and modern CodeMeter or NetHASP licensing.
When users attempt to run these versions side-by-side or migrate settings, the "Virtual USB Bus" driver is often the component that requires troubleshooting. Common Installation Challenges
When setting up a virtual bus link for Mastercam, users typically encounter three main hurdles: 1. Driver Signature Enforcement
Modern Windows versions (10/11) will not load drivers unless they are digitally signed by a trusted authority. Many virtual USB bus links are viewed as "unsigned." To bypass this, users often have to put Windows into Test Mode (using the bcdedit -set TESTSIGNING ON command), though this is generally not recommended for production machines due to security risks. 2. Conflict with Sentinel HASP Drivers
Mastercam 2022 installs the latest Sentinel Runtime environment. If an older virtual USB bus link from an X7 installation is still active, it may cause a "Blue Screen of Death" (BSOD) or prevent the newer software from seeing the legitimate license. 3. Registry Mapping
The virtual bus link relies on specific Registry keys (found under H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\MultiKey). For the link to work across both X7 and 2022, the dump data within these registry folders must be formatted correctly for the emulator to read. Troubleshooting Steps
If you are facing a "No SIM Found" or "HASP Not Found" error while using a virtual link:
Check Device Manager: Look under "Universal Serial Bus controllers." If you see "Virtual USB Bus" with a yellow exclamation mark, the driver is blocked by Windows security.
Update the Sentinel Runtime: Ensure you are using the LDK Runtime 8.x or higher, which is compatible with Mastercam 2022.
Clean Registry: Remove old emulator traces before installing a new virtual link to prevent driver collisions. The Shift Toward Software Licensing
It is important to note that CNC Software (the makers of Mastercam) has moved aggressively toward Software Licensing. This removes the need for virtual USB bus links entirely, as the license is tied to the computer's unique ID rather than a physical or emulated USB port. If you are upgrading to Mastercam 2022, transitioning to a software-based "activation" license is the most stable path forward.
Disclaimer: This article is for educational purposes regarding software compatibility and driver management. Always ensure you are using genuine licenses provided by authorized Mastercam resellers to ensure software stability and access to technical support.
Mastercam versions from X7 through 2022 often rely on a "Virtual USB Bus Link" (frequently implemented via drivers like MultiKey) to emulate physical hardware security keys (HASP/NetHASP). This setup allows the software to recognize a license without a physical dongle plugged into a USB port. Core Components & Setup
To establish a successful virtual bus link, the following elements are typically required:
Virtual USB Bus Enumerator: This is the core driver that appears in your Windows Device Manager under "System devices" once installed. Mastercam X7 2022 Virtual USB Bus Link Guide
MultiKey Emulator: A common third-party utility used to manage the virtual link. It translates registry data into a format the Mastercam license service understands.
Registry (.reg) Files: These files contain the "dump" or digital signature of the license. They must be merged into the Windows Registry to provide the emulator with the necessary license information.
HASP/Sentinel Drivers: Even with a virtual link, Mastercam still requires the official Sentinel HASP drivers (like HASPUserSetup.exe) to communicate with the emulated key. Common Installation Steps
The process generally follows this sequence across versions from X7 to 2022:
Preparation: Disable User Account Control (UAC) and Digital Driver Signing Enforcement (Test Mode). Modern Windows versions (10/11) strictly block unsigned virtual drivers like the bus link unless these are disabled.
Registry Entry: Double-click the provided .reg file to add the license data to your system.
Driver Installation: Run the driver installer (e.g., install.bat or mkinstall_x64.exe) as an Administrator. You should see a "Drivers installed successfully" message.
Verification: Open Device Manager. You should see "Virtual USB Multikey" under System Devices and "SafeNet Inc. HASP/USB Key" under Universal Serial Bus Controllers. Troubleshooting "Error 39" or "Link Failed"
If the virtual bus link fails to start, consider these common fixes:
Driver Signing: Ensure Windows is in Test Mode. If not, the virtual driver will be blocked by the OS.
Corrupt Profile: Some users report that a corrupt Windows User Profile can prevent the virtual HASP from being recognized. Creating a new user profile often resolves persistent launch issues.
Driver Conflict: Ensure any old versions of the emulator are completely removed using a "cleaner" or "remove" script before installing a version compatible with Mastercam 2022. Mastercam USB HASP issue - eMastercam.com
The Mastercam X7-2022 Virtual USB Bus refers to a legacy driver and emulation bridge used to manage software licensing for Mastercam versions spanning from X7 through 2022. It primarily functions as a virtual hardware interface that allows the software to recognize a license key—often a virtualized HASP or NetHASP—without requiring a physical USB dongle to be plugged into the machine at all times. Overview of the Virtual USB Bus Link
The virtual USB bus acts as an intermediate layer between the Windows operating system and Mastercam’s licensing service. While modern versions of Mastercam (2023 and newer) have moved toward software-based activation, the X7 to 2022 era relied heavily on the Virtual USB Bus Enumerator to provide stability for network licenses and virtualized keys. Key Components and Technical Details
Driver Identification: In the Windows Device Manager, this link appears under "System devices" as the Virtual USB Bus Enumerator.
Hardware ID: The specific hardware ID associated with this driver is often ROOT\MCAMVUSB7.
Supported Systems: The driver is compatible with Windows 7, 8.1, 10, and 11 (both 32-bit and 64-bit architectures).
Associated Utilities: It often works in tandem with the NHasp or HaspX utilities, which are used to toggle between local and network license modes. Common Issues and Troubleshooting
Users frequently encounter errors related to this virtual link, such as "Error 39" or Mastercam failing to launch despite showing as active in the Task Manager. Mastercam X7-2022 Virtual Usb Bus Error 39 - Google Groups
Let me clarify the probable meanings and provide you with a structured academic/technical paper outline based on the most likely interpretations.
Scenario A: Running Mastercam X7 on Windows 10/11 (The "X72022" Transition)
You have a valid physical NetHASP dongle for Mastercam X7, but your company upgraded all workstations to Windows 11. The X7 driver (haspnt.sys) fails to load because it is not WHQL-certified for the new OS. By installing a virtual USB bus (e.g., from Eltima Software or VirtualHere), you can:
- Isolate the legacy driver inside a compatibility layer.
- Link the physical dongle (plugged into a USB port) to the virtual bus, which then presents it to Mastercam as a compliant device.
If you are looking for a crack/patch for Mastercam (illegal):
- No legitimate paper exists because "Mastercam X72022 Virtual USB Bus Link" is a term from crack forums (e.g., using
vusbbus.sys,mccamx7.dll, or emulators like "USB Network Gate" to bypass the hasp dongle). - Using or distributing such material violates copyright law (DMCA, EUCD) and Mastercam's EULA. CNC Software Inc. actively pursues legal action against users of cracked software.
Consequences:
- Legal liability (lawsuits, fines up to $150,000 per instance in the US).
- Malware risk (cracked USB emulators often contain ransomware or keyloggers).
- No technical support or updates.
Paper Title Proposal
“Evaluation of a Virtual USB Bus Link for Real-Time Toolpath Data Transfer in Mastercam 2022: A Simulation-Based Approach”
What is a Virtual USB Bus Link?
A Virtual USB Bus link is a software solution that creates a tunnel between a computer (the client) and a remote USB device (the server). In practical terms, it allows a program running on one computer to "see" and communicate with a USB device plugged into a completely different computer on the same network.
For Mastercam users, this is most commonly applied to the USB Hardware Key (Dongle).